NEWFANZONE BPL TEAM OF THE WEEK WEEK 4

After the end of another exciting week in the EPL Newfanzone.com take a look at the players that performed brilliantly and therefore make our NEWFANZONE BPL TEAM oF THE WEEK

FORMATION- 4-2-3-1

GOALKEEPER: BEN HAMER– The Leicester city. Second choice goalie made his EPL debut when first choice Kasper Schmeichel was forced to miss the game due to injury he sustained during the international break with Denmark. Hamer made sure Leicester took all three points from the Hawthorns with spectacular saves and even a double save from Diouf and Moses close to the end of the game.

RIGHT BACK: RAFAEL DA SILVA– Rafael played his socks off at the right back position for Manchester United. Even though you’ll say its against QPR the Brazillian showed why he would want to make that right back his own.

LEFT BACK: GAEL CLICHY– He was so unlucky not to get a goal against his former club. He was both assured at the back as well as in front.

CENTRE BACK: VINCENT KOMPANY- The Manchester city captain through his whole body in the line to scupper all the attack Arsenal brought to him. He was not afraid to go into tackles and made sure Arsenal new boy Danny Welbeck was silent for most part of the game.

CENTRE BACK: In the Absence of Ron Vlaar, Swiss international Philipe Sanderos coordinated his back line as Aston Villa left Anfield without conceding a goal. He was not fazed by Balotelli antics but kept his calm as they move two points off the Summit of the EPL.

DEFENSIVE MIDFIELD: MOGRAN SCHNEIDERLIN– The Saints Captain showed he has put what happened in the transfer window behind him by putting in a spectacular performance against Newcastle in their biggest win of the season. He even capped his fine performance with a 90th minute goal.

HOLDING MIDFIELD: ANDER HERRERA– The former Bilbao man is a man to watch for the New look United side this season. Ability to pick out players by providing assists and also scoring his fair share of goals. His performance against Harry Redknapp side sure makes him a sure bet for our team of the week.

ATTACKING MIDFIELD: JACK WILSHERE– The young English man was obviously Arsenal best player on the pitch of play against Manchester City. He got the needed equaliser and also an assist to make sure Arsenal salvaged a point at the Emirates. His overall play was also excellent which moved his coach Arsene Wenger to heap praises on Jack.

LEFT WINGER: ANGEL DI MARIA– The Angel has finally arrived in England. He scored a sublime free kick and also got an assist bagging a MOTM award against QPR as he looked to be an exciting signing for Louis Van Gaal.

RIGHT WINGER: ALEXIS SANCHEZ– Alexis work rate against the defending champions was excellent and his goal fantastic. The Chilean alongside Wilshere were Arsenal Brightest spark in the game and they together brought Arsenal back into the game.

FORWARD: DIEGO COSTA- Seven goals in the last four games, an Hat-trick in the last match-day Diego Costa positional sense and finishing is what Chelsea needs if they want to win the EPL this season. If Costa keep scoring then Chelsea will keep winning.
